Artificial turf can get warm under direct sunlight, but cooling infill materials or water misting can help reduce the temperature.

Installation typically involves the following steps:

  1. Clearing the area and removing existing grass

  2. Installing a base layer of crushed stone and dust.

  3. Laying the turf and securing it with nails or adhesive

  4. Brushing and adding infill for stability

Yes, artificial turf can be installed over concrete, patios, or decks using a foam underlayment for added comfort and drainage.

While low maintenance, artificial turf benefits from occasional:

  • Brushing to keep fibers upright

  • Hosing down to remove dust and debris

  • Removing pet waste promptly

  • Refilling infill as needed

Yes! Most artificial turf comes with a perforated backing that allows rainwater and spills to drain efficiently.

Yes, artificial turf conserves water, reduces the need for pesticides and fertilizers, and eliminates gas-powered lawn equipment usage. Some turf options are even made from recyclable materials.

The cost varies depending on quality and installation but typically ranges from $5 to $20 per square foot, including labor.
